Market Overview:
The global iron oxide for cosmetic pigments market is expected to register a CAGR of 5.8% during the forecast period, 2018-2030. The growth in the market can be attributed to factors such as rising demand for color cosmetics, increasing awareness about personal care and hygiene, and growing inclination of consumers towards natural ingredients in cosmetics products. Based on type, the global iron oxide for cosmetic pigments market is segmented into yellow iron oxides, red iron oxides, black iron oxides, brown iron oxides (including hematite), blue irons odes (including cobalt), and other types. Among these segments, yellow irons odes are expected to witness highest growth during the forecast period owing to their versatile properties that make them suitable for use in various applications such as facial make-up products and lipsticks. Product Definition:
Iron Oxide is a mineral that can be found in nature and is also produced through industrial processes. It occurs in several different colors including yellow, red, black and brown. The mineral has a variety of uses including cosmetic pigments, paint pigments, rust inhibitors and more.

Red Iron Oxides:
Red iron oxide is a type of iron oxide, which has been used as a colorant in cosmetics and the pharmaceutical industry. The product is available in different forms such as dust, powder, pellet and solution. It can be produced by both thermal decomposition (calcination) method as well as chemical synthesis method.
Application Insights:
Facial make-up application dominated the global iron oxide for cosmetic pigments market, accounting for over 35% of the overall revenue share in 2017. The segment is expected to witness significant growth during the forecast period on account of increasing demand from Asia Pacific and Middle East countries. In addition, growing awareness regarding skin care among women across the globe is anticipated to further drive product demand in this segment.
The lip products application segment accounted for a revenue share of over 30% in 2017 and is projected to grow at a steady CAGR from 2018 to 2030 owing to rising consumer preference towards natural looking lips coupled with an increase in disposable income levels among consumers globally. Furthermore, growing trend towards lipsticks that are infused with moisturizing properties will also boost market growth during the forecast period.

Regional Analysis:
Asia Pacific dominated the global market in 2017 and is expected to continue its dominance over the forecast period. The growth of this region can be attributed to increasing demand for cosmetic products from countries, such as China, India, Japan, South Korea and Indonesia. Rapidly growing cosmetics industry coupled with rising purchasing power of consumers in these countries will drive product demand further.
